Finance Review Summary — Board Distribution

Warranty costs on the Torvan HX compressor line exceeded reserve by 31% this quarter, driven by a valve-seal defect in units shipped from the Greymont plant between March and June. A supplier claim is in progress; recovery estimates range from 40–60% of the overrun. Reserves for the next two quarters have been raised accordingly. Implications for the product roadmap appear in the confidential note below.

board note of bawep-tajef: Queniusek Systems plans to raise the Quenvan list price by 53.1 percent in March. The pricing group signed off on a budget of $176.4 million for Project Drueth. The renewal with Casionix Partners closes at $142.5 million a year, 8.3 percent below the last contract. Project Fraax slips by six weeks because of the tooling delay.

Welcome to on-call for the Glimmerpane design system! Our snapshot tests live in the `snapcheck` suite and run on every merge to main. If a UI component changes visually, the diff bot flags it — usually it's an intentional tweak, so just approve the new baseline. If it's 2am and snapshots are failing across the board, it's almost always a font-loading race, not your problem. To unlock the baseline store and re-approve snapshots in bulk, use the recovery passphrase below.

recovery phrase for tahag-taguf: wenix-caswyn

Subject: Billing worker blue-green cut-over done

Hi,

The Tallowgate billing worker finished its blue-green cut-over this morning. Green pool took full traffic at 09:20; blue drained cleanly with zero dropped invoices. The deploy scripts you reviewed ran unmodified. We kept blue warm for 24 hours as a fallback, then it gets scaled down. Green is currently running with the configuration below.

settings of tagef-bawif:
DRUIX_HOST=druix.zemvarlabs.internal
DRUIX_PORT=8000

## Runbook: Perchline Broker Upgrade (Plugin Authors)

Before upgrading against Perchline 5.2, external plugins must re-handshake using the new capability negotiation flow. Pin your SDK to the compatibility branch, run the conformance suite twice, and confirm ack semantics under replay. Any support request must quote the exact broker build you tested against, which we publish below for this rollout.

trace token, fafog-kageg: htk4_98e6